Description

Cruise across Lake Atitlán and visit the charming village of San Juan La Laguna on this full-day shared sightseeing tour. Surrounded by three majestic volcanoes along its southern shore. Join this tour to immerse yourself in authentic Mayan traditions. In San Juan La Laguna, you’ll have the opportunity to witness a live demonstration by local Mayan women, who use tree bark, natural plants, and vegetables to extract vibrant natural dyes. Learn how these ancestral techniques are used to color handwoven textiles, preserving centuries-old craftsmanship. Continue Lake Atitlán by boat as you travel to Santiago Atitlán to meet the Tz’utujil Maya community. Discover their rich spiritual beliefs, including a visit to the revered Mayan deity Maximón, also known as Rilaj Mam, considered a powerful grandfather spirit. You’ll also explore local art galleries, handicrafts, and traditional paintings, gaining deeper insight into the vibrant culture

Itinerary

45 min

Your guide will meet you at your hotel in Panajachel and walk with you to the boat dock. From there, you’ll take a scenic boat ride across Lake Atitlán for about 40 minutes to San Juan La Laguna. It’s a beautiful journey over the water, surrounded by stunning volcano views and charming lakeside villages along the way

180 min

Upon arrival in San Juan La Laguna, after a safe and speedy 40-minute boat ride across Lake Atitlán, you will begin exploring this magical town with your professional guide. Enjoy a fully guided cultural tour as you walk through colorful streets filled with vibrant murals and local art. Visit artisan cooperatives to learn about traditional backstrap weaving, natural dye processes, and the rich heritage of the Tz’utujil Maya community. You’ll also have the opportunity to discover local chocolate and coffee production, making this experience both cultural and flavorful.

120 min

After enjoying your time in San Juan La Laguna, you will disconnect from this charming village and board the same safe boat to ride across Lake Atitlán toward Santiago Atitlán. Upon arrival, prepare for a wonderful and immersive experience in the rich Mayan Tz’utujil culture. With your guide, you’ll explore local markets, traditional streets, and important cultural sites, learning about ancestral traditions, daily life, and spiritual beliefs that continue to shape the community today Once arrived at Santiago Aitlan, you have a guided tour to explore the great visit at Maya Tzutujil family to presence the performice of Local dress up, then continue to main Church as amazing syncretims between Mayan and chathilics religous

40 min

After a wonderful experience in Santiago Atitlán, you will board a safe boat for the scenic ride back across Lake Atitlán to Panajachel. As you arrive in Panajachel, your memorable journey comes to an end. You will say goodbye to your local guide, taking with you unforgettable memories of breathtaking landscapes, rich culture, and authentic Mayan traditions experienced throughout the day
